Description

This course is based on the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C)'s Guidance for Where You Live, Work, Learn, Pray, and Play. In this course, we feature detailed guidance and activities for employers, schools, and child care providers, as well as for other types of organizations.

The course also covers the White House Three Phase Approach, OSHA employee health considerations, Decision Tools, Cleaning and Disinfecting, and resource links to CDC Guidance and information for businesses and organizations including:

- First Responders and Law Enforcement
- Parks and Recreational Faciliies
- Community and Faith-Based Organizations
- Small Businesses
- Tribal Communities
- Meat and Poultry Processors
- Manufacturing
- Youth Programs and Camps

The guidance is supported by the CDC's Community Mitigation Framework: Actions that individuals, businesses, health departments, and community settings (such as schools) can take to slow the spread of COVID-19. This guidance was released on May 14, 2020.
